Program Description

Associate in Science Degree

The Theater Arts program gives students a strong foundation in the performance and technical fields of the dramatic arts. The curriculum is a blend of theory and concept with practical, handson experience in a variety of professions in theater and performing arts. The program offers a wide range of study appropriate for nonmajors pursuing a liberal arts education as well as majors preparing for a professional performing arts career.

The Theatre Arts Associate Degree meets the standards for MassTransfer, which is a statewide transfer program that provides Community College students the ability to transfer to a Massachusetts State Universities and the University of Massachusetts System. Students should meet with an academic advisor and use DegreeWorks to review the proper program and course selection for transfer to a four-year State College/University.

Massasoit produces and promotes a performance series throughout the year for the college and community that encompasses contemporary and classical music, dance and theatre. The Massasoit Theatre Company, a community theatre sponsored by the college, also produces a season of plays and musicals.

Activities associated with Theatre Arts include an extracurricular job shadow and training program that gives students the opportunity to work directly with theatre professionals and learn various technical theatre skills. Each student in the program is paired with a mentor who guides them through the technical theatre process from start to finish.

Buckley Performing Arts Center

The Buckley Performing Arts Center, named for Senator Anna Buckley, who was instrumental in siting a community college in the City of Brockton, is the theatrical hub of the bustling Fine Arts Building. A resource for the college and the surrounding community, the Fine Arts Building is home to two modern theaters, a state-of-the-art television studio, a radio studio, a painting studio, the Media Center and the college Children’s Daycare Center, not to mention classrooms and staff offices.Massasoit produces and promotes a performance series throughout the year for the college and community that encompasses contemporary and classical music, dance and theatre. The Massasoit Theatre Company, a community theatre sponsored by the college produces a season of plays and musicals, and is home to the Massasoit Student Ensemble.

Massasoit Ensembles

The Massasoit Student Ensemble produces two productions a year, providing opportunities for performance and technical training. It also includes an extracurricular job shadow and training program that gives students the opportunity to work directly with theatre professionals and learn various technical theatre skills. Each student in the program is paired with a mentor who guides them through the technical theatre process from start to finish.

Practical Theatre Ensemble (P.T.E.) is an academic program where we get to combine the theatrical skills we are learning in class, with the practical application of a rehearsal process. Truly an ensemble, we collaborate on a script, exploring acting, design, marketing, and stage management, culminating in a showcase of our work to invited guests.

Clubs

Performix is a Performing Arts Club for students who want to become more involved in exploring arts opportunities and participating in activities to further their performance skill set.

Radio Club is a student run organization supporting the Radio Massasoit internet radio station. Its purpose is to provide broadcasting opportunities to students and train them in the operation of a radio station.

Media Axis Club is for students involved in the television side of the media club. They can expect to get immediate quality hands-on training in television production. The media club provides a stepping-stone to those who are considering a career in any aspect of media communications.
